Product Overview

The job scheduler is the central point for your HPC infrastructure. It dispatches and monitors the jobs on the available resources, keeping track of the jobs' allocation and their state. The generated data are stored in the job scheduler's accounting logs, from which valuable information can be extracted in order to understand the cluster behavior.
For example, the analysis of the logs makes it possible to identify practices and historical events that influence the overall cluster performance: which users are requesting more resources; which kind of jobs wait more time in the queue before starting; resources consumption per job state, and so on. Understanding the historical behavior of the cluster is crucial to choose the proper actions towards increasing production and profitability.
That is why we have developed Analyze-IT. By processing the job-submission historical data in the logs, Analyze-IT creates detailed analyses of the behavior of the jobs on your cluster. Moreover, it delivers a report containing indicators and insights about your HPC infrastructure.

This 'AWS Budget' version of Analyze-IT features a costs estimation plugin that allows you to estimate the budget you will need to run a selected workload on AWS, including cost for: Services, Compute, Storage, Remote Visualization and Data-Transfer.
